[Bug 161150] Compiz locks screen randomly on ubuntu gutsy

2007-11-09 Thread David Mills
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: compiz

When running compiz on ubuntu Gutsy, the screen stops accepting input
(keyboard or mouse) randomly (once or twice a day).

When the screen is blocked, the cursor still moves around the screen,
and keeps it's shape (arror, I ...).

It is possible to recover the screen using ctrlaltsysR then
ctrlaltf5 to get to a usable console, and killing compiz.real from
this console.

Note: I tried to run xkill from the console (using export DISPLAY=:0)
but I was told that it couldn't grab the cursor.

[Bug 115406] Ubiquity doesn't handle the case of /boot being on a different partition from /

2007-05-18 Thread David Mills
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: ubiquity

When I installed ubuntu 7.04 on a laptop, I made /boot a seperate
partition, to get arround a possible cylinder 1024 bug.

The install finished fine, but grub wasn't configured correctly, the
entries for Ubuntu referenced my / partition, using /boot/... instead of
referencing my boot partition, using the path /vmlinuz...

This can be worked arround by tweeking grub on first boot and then
fixing /boot/grub/menu.lst but only for an experienced user.

[Bug 70917] Re: kernel hangs for a few seconds during boot

2007-05-14 Thread David Mills
OK, I managed to resolve this bug by adding 'irqpoll' to my kernel
parameters.

The only thing is that I don't know if this could be added by default
since according to google it also breaks some stuff in interesting ways.

That, and IANA Kernel Programmer
